OK, Blue is still breaking in but I think with a loud drummer and playing classic rock the budda speakers are still it. Now, next day was a low volume gign playing country and lighter rock. The Blue/Budda speaker combo shined there. The Blue helped the TM soften up in a good way at a little lower volume. Bottom line: TM in a head cab w/ different speaker cabs :-) Rock on Budda heads.
